isola lo scoglio... yesterday


In 1848 the islet where the hotel is situated was owned by Baron Della Ratta. In the 1940s it was Princes’ Granito di Belmonte summer residence.

 

In the 1950s it became a small guesthouse with a restaurant and an elegant dance hall, which was a fashionable meeting place also during the 1960s and 1970s.

 

In that period Mr. Giovanni Gabriele Quarta bought it from the Ministry of Tourism, which had acquired it from the previous owner.

 

Isola lo Scoglio is a cult place in the collective memory of many generations of people living in Salento.
